Lets compare vitamin content per 500 calories of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t vs Beer:
500 calories of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t have more Vitamin A, 7.1 times more Vitamin B1, 2 times more Vitamin B2, 1.5 times more Vitamin B3, 6.3 times more Vitamin B5, 4.6 times more Vitamin B6, 2.5 times more Vitamin B9, more Vitamin C, more Vitamin E and more Vitamin K than Beer.
500 calories of Beer have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B1, Vitamin B5, Vitamin C, Vitamin E and Vitamin K
Both Canned Carrots Solids and Liquids with Salt as well as Regular Beer have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in 500 calories.
Comparing minerals per 500 calories for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t vs Beer:
500 calories of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t have 14.5 times more Calcium, 38.5 times more Copper, 48.6 times more Iron, 2.8 times more Magnesium, 105.2 times more Manganese, 2.7 times more Phosphorus, 12 times more Potassium, 1.2 times more Selenium, 112.2 times more Sodium, 54.2 times more Zinc and 1.9 times more Water than Beer.
500 calories of Beer lack sufficient amounts of Calcium, Copper, Iron, Manganese, Potassium and Zinc
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 500 calories:
500 calories of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t have more Omega 3, 2.8 times more Carbohydrate, more Sugars, more Fiber and 2.4 times more Protein than Beer.
Both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t and Beer offer comparable quantities of Energy per 500 calories.
500 calories of Beer provide inadequate amounts of Omega 3, Fiber and Protein
Both Canned Carrots Solids and Liquids with Salt as well as Regular Beer provide inadequate amounts of Omega 6 in 500 calories.
